There is a no that makes a "giant" noise. This is what the mayor of Cabras Andrea Abis said a few days ago on the balance sheet of the Mont'e Prama Foundation .

In Cabras in these hours we are no longer just talking about elections and the first political maneuvers in view of the renewal of the municipal council. But also of a rift between the body that manages the town museum and the Municipality of Cabras, a founding member of the Foundation together with the Ministry of Culture and the Region.

Abis a few days ago was the only one to oppose the document voted instead by the president of the Anthony Muroni Foundation and by the directors Paolo Fresu, Patricia Olivo, Efisio Trincas and Graziella Pinna.

Understanding the reasons for the no, i.e. what choices the Foundation made that the mayor did not share, is not yet known.

Abis said few words: «At the moment I don't agree with an administrative decision of the Foundation that I strongly wanted. The no doesn't come from Andrea Abis but from the Municipality that I legally represent. I have to protect the interests of the community."

A no to the budget and therefore to the management of resources that comes after Abis has carefully consulted the papers: «I arrived at the vote convinced of my decision on the basis of the opinions I had in hand. As I was convinced in the past when I made difficult decisions always about the museum, but very important for the community».

If Abis says something from Anthony Muroni, president of the Foundation, absolute silence. For now, he prefers not to make any statements.
